SINA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

151 of the 4,538 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Sina Corp (SINA)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$1.28B — down 24% from $1.68B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 28 funds closed out of SINA and 18 opened new positions — a net loss of 10 holders — while 66 trimmed existing stakes and 40 added.

The largest buyer was Prime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$45.8M. The largest seller was HBK Investments, exiting entirely with an estimated $70.8M sold.
